[05:31] On Saturday night, the developers started introducing Invasions.

  • The Rifts/Invasions adjust to the number of active players in the area.
  • Towns were being invaded; people had to fight through them to finish their quests.
  • You can run around and complete your quests or just run around and try to fend off the Rifts and Invasions!
  • Invasions will destroy Quest Hubs, so sometimes you will have to take back that area to continue your quests.

[13:28] How was the Customer Service system working?

  • The bug report/customer issues/etc service ran pretty smoothly.
  • There were Customer Service Representatives (CSRs) available all weekend.
  • The CSRs were keeping up with the emails and petitions, and many were handled very quickly.
  • They still don’t have a full Customer Service team yet.
